Monmouth County is located in Central New Jersey and is one of the state's nine counties. The county seat is Freehold Borough. Monmouth County is made up of 38 municipalities, including 26 townships and 12 boroughs. Some of Monmouth County's most notable landmarks include the Monmouth Battlefield State Park, the Belmar Boardwalk, and the Jenkinson's Aquarium. The county's top employers include pharmaceutical companies like Johnson & Johnson and Bristol-Myers Squibb, as well as the U.S. Navy Undersea Warfare Center. Major highways and roads in Monmouth County include Route 18, Route 33, and the Garden State Parkway. The county's most populous neighborhoods include Asbury Park, Red Bank, and Middletown.

Mortgage loan officers in Monmouth County, NJ are typically compensated in one of three ways: salary, commission, or a combination of the two. Salaried mortgage loan officers receive a set wage regardless of how many loans they close. Commission-based mortgage loan officers are paid a percentage of the value of the loans they close. Some companies also offer a hybrid compensation plan that combines a salary with commissions. Which type of compensation plan is best for you depends on your goals and lifestyle.
